Output 80e4db74f069784924c9cfdafb9fbd545d7c01694776e8f40b579df5bfe3d152:4

value
179000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c044711c12cba42f247e23025a0ab09f4f119f4 OP_EQUAL
address
3ETMecZNwa5c6E4G4y2oZ7B532jXCSW3j2
transaction
80e4db74f069784924c9cfdafb9fbd545d7c01694776e8f40b579df5bfe3d152
confirmations
222544
spent
true